
23
DXD FIRMWARE CHANGE SUMMARY
The major firmware enhancements from Firmware Version
2.15 to Version 3.23 firmware for the DXD are listed below for
reference. Page references pertain to the detailed operational
specifications for the DXD.
1. Alternate Engineering Units (AEU) were added to the com-
mand set. The DXD will respond in PSI or 10 other units of
measure. (Page 34-36, 38 & 42).
2. Error status response character (ASCII sub code “ack” /
“nak” or ASCII literal “A” / “N”) is now appended to each
response of the DXD. The error status response type is
selected via the mode byte at location 001 in the EEProm.
The appended character can also be switched off using
a bit in the mode byte. This places the unit in “Legacy”
mode. (Page 38).
3. Error Flag status Byte command has been added to the
Command Library. “#**EF” will send back an error byte. If a
“nak” or “N” is appended to a response the error byte will
inform the user what the error source was.
4. The lock byte in EEProm (location 127) now locks the
entire EEProm (except location 127) from access with the
“#**ew” command (page 29). To write with the “ew” com-
mand, location 127 must be set to “093”.
5. A “rolling average” filter has been added . It is accessed
through the commands “FA” or “FB”, & “fa” or “fb”. FA is
filter amount, and FB is filter band. The limits of FA are 1,
2, 4, 8, or 16 readings to be averaged. FB limits are .002%
to 9.999% of 50,000 counts, and sets the band of counts
change tolerance to the averaging routine. If a change
outside of the FB limits is seen, the averaging registers are
reset and the new pressure reading is displayed immedi-
ately. The amount of counts selected for FB can be seen at
locations 158 & 159 in EEProm. (Pages 29, 30, & 40, 41).
6. The addressed DXD must now recognize it’s address prior
to doing an A/D update, and only the “PS”, “RC”, “ST” and
“AEU” commands will generate an update. This speeds up
the response time of the DXD to commands not requiring
pressure update information.
7. UZ, “User Zero” read function
For sensors such as 6000 and 7500 psi, which originally
did not have a decimal point in their response string, one is
now included; example
UZ=+000001.ackcrlf
15 characters (ack/nak mode)
UZ=+000001.Acrlf
14 characters (A/N mode)
UZ=+000001.crlf
13 characters (Legacy mode)
7a. uz “user zero” write function
For sensors such as 6000 and 7500 psi, which originally
did not have a decimal point in their response string, one
now must be included; example, #**uz+000002.
8. UT “User Tare” read function
For sensors such as 6000 and 7500 psi, which originally
did not have a decimal point in their response string, one is
now included; example,
UT=+000001.ackcrlf
14 characters (ack/nak mode)
UT=+000001.Acrlf
14 characters (A/N mode)
UT=+000001.crlf
13 characters (Legacy mode)
8a. ut “user tare” write function
For sensors such as 6000 and 7500 psi, which originally
did not have a decimal point in their response string, one
now must be included; example #**ut+000002.
Содержание DXD Series
Страница 2: ...ii...
Страница 51: ...49 PAGE INTENTIONALLY BLANK...
Страница 54: ...52...
Страница 73: ...71...